Globus Adds Custom Options, Plus Agent Pay on New Excursions Travel Market Report Vacations By Rail added five new independent train tour s to its Europe lineup. New packages include the following city combinations: Berlin-Prague-Vienna, Paris-French Riviera, Prague-Vienna-Budapest, Rome-Florence-Venice and Vienna-Salzburg-Munich. |

Card charges and booking 'tricks' revealed by consumer study
February 22,2012 07:26 PM
Hundreds of travel companies are still using expensive card charges, premium rate telephone lines and automatic opt-ins to “trick” their customers into paying extra for their services, despite impending EU legislation to ban the practices.
